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ized sealants or coatings to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. This process aims to create a protective barrier that prevents moisture, water infiltration, and soil gases from penetrating the concrete. Proper sealing helps maintain the integrity of the foundation by reducing the risk of cracks, deterioration, and structural issues caused by water damage. The application typically requires careful surface preparation, including cleaning and repairing any existing damage, before the sealant is applied evenly across the foundation surface.

One of the primary issues that foundation sealing addresses is water intrusion, which can lead to significant structural problems over time. Excess moisture can cause concrete to weaken, crack, or erode, and may also promote mold growth in the basement or crawl space areas. Additionally, sealing helps prevent soil gases, such as radon, from seeping into the property, which can pose health concerns. By creating a moisture-resistant barrier, foundation sealing services help preserve the stability and longevity of the structure, reducing the likelihood of costly repairs caused by water-related damage.

Material and Surface Preparation - Costs for sealing concrete foundations typically range from $300 to $800, depending on the size and condition of the surface. Larger or heavily damaged foundations may incur higher exp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.

Type of Sealant Used - The choice of sealant influences the overall cost, with basic sealants costing around $2 to $4 per square foot, while specialized or high-performance options may be $5 to $8 per square foot. The selection depends on the desired durability and application specifics.

Labor and Application - Labor costs for sealing services usually add $200 to $600 to the total, varying with foundation size and complexity. Professional application ensures proper sealing but can impact overall expenses based on local rates.

Additional Repairs or Preparations - If foundation cracks or damage require repairs before sealing, costs can increase by $500 or more. Proper preparation is essential for effective sealing and may influence the final price estimate provided by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
